Southern Illinois University Edwardsville vs Southeast Missouri State University
Compare the rivalry schools -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ville and Southeast Missouri State University.
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ville (SIUE) is a Public, 4-years school located in Edwardsville, IL and Southeast Missouri State University (Southeast Missouri State) is a Public, 4-years school located in Cape Girardeau, MO.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
- Southeast Missouri State University has higher submitted SAT score (1,080) than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ville (1,050).
- Southeast Missouri State University (86.31% acceptance rate) is tighter than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ville (97.51% acceptance rate) to get in.
-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ville (12,519 students) is larger than Southeast Missouri State University (9,927 students).
-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ville has more expensive tuition & fees of $12,922 than Southeast Missouri State University($9,496).
- Southern Illinois University-Edwardsville has more full-time faculties of 631 faculties than Southeast Missouri State University(381 facluties).
